This different type of space is mainly due to the settlement principles that characterized the urban evolution of the city of Milan, as the northern part is the result of a well designed and studied project and was generated through well-defined principles and hierarchies; it is in fact the oldest and most historical part, still contained within the last ring road. While in the south the building has undergone a process that is often uncontrolled, in which the presence of low buildings and industrial use.

03 URBAN AND LANDSCAPE REGENERATION-morimondo-ITALY The project area is part of a very interesting environmental and landscape system characterized by waterways, historic centers and monumental constructions (but also unused and deteriorated buildings), natural protected areas, intensive agricultural activities, proximities with important urban contexts. In this scenario it is possible to work on a very contemporary issue, that is how to obtain a resilient regeneration of rural areas able to guarantee the permanence of the environmental, cultural and landscape values, but also the economic sustainability of the transformation. Rural regeneration is one of the major "Societal Challenges" in EU politics because phenomena like sealed soil, industrial expansion, increasing of logistic infrastructures, crises of traditional agricultural activity, loss of biodiversity due to intensive rural activities have produced in the last years a progressive abandoning and a degradation of buildings and landscape.





04 RIVERSIDE-ARCHITECTURE -PIACENZA-ITALY The project imagined an ideal situation for connecting the historical city in the front of the railway station with the po river.the power station is demolished,the highway is replaced by underground express path,and therailway station is renovated.these three steps solve the most difficult problem in our site:the noises,the block,the unsafety,the pollution,and unaccessibility,in condition of this situation,our project promote an active new musical-riverside urban area. Po river has both positive and negative effect on piacenza.the flood is aninevitable problem for the city,as it drowns the riverbank behind theembankment every year.however,the river provides a natural space with large area of green and trees;it also attract residences in piacenza to gothere to have a relax time. thus,we bring the river into the city,passing through the railway. It is suggested that the city need a new auditorium.as a large scale cutural facility,it needs large area of space with convenient transportation.it would be a new attraction for the city.thus,the auditorium will be the newattraction node for the city. The new water way comes across to the railway station.the railway lines block the new part of the city with the ancient city.we build a new platform over the railway which connects the both sides of the railway.at the sametime,the blocks are the new city parts with commerce,culture and residence.
